Megaptera novaeangliae
The humpback whale or Megaptera novaeangliae is a familiar of baleen whale. Adults reach a length from 12 to 16 m (39 to 52 ft) and weigh about 36,000 kg (79,000 lb). This whale features a unique body shape, long pectoral fins and a knobbly head.
This species is known for breaching and other distinctive surface behaviors, making it popular with whale watchers. Males produce a complex song lasting 10 to 20 minutes, which they repeat for hours at a time. Its purpose is not clear, though it may have a role in mating.

The Season

The humpback whale is generally sighted between July and October, being August the month of more sightings.
